The normal seasonal rainfall measured at downtown Los Angeles is 14.77 inches, of which 92% falls between November 1 and April 30. Rainfall in Los Angeles is quite scarce, amounting to about 375 millimeters (15 inches) per year, and has a similar pattern to that of the Mediterranean climate, but with a drier autumn, since most of the rain falls from December to March, while in summer, it almost never rains.
